CouchDB vs GridGain In-Memory Data Fabric : Which is Better?

CouchDB icon

CouchDB

Apache CouchDB is open source database software. Developed by Apache Software Foundation

License: Open Source

Categories: Development

Apps available for Mac OS X Windows Linux Android BSD

VS
VS
GridGain In-Memory Data Fabric icon

GridGain In-Memory Data Fabric

GridGain In-Memory Data Fabric is an in-memory computing platform. Developed by GridGain Systems, Inc

License: Open Source

Apps available for Windows Linux

CouchDB VS GridGain In-Memory Data Fabric

CouchDB excels in providing a reliable document-oriented database with strong replication and synchronization capabilities, making it suitable for applications needing high availability. GridGain, on the other hand, focuses on high-performance in-memory data processing and real-time analytics, making it ideal for applications requiring fast data access and processing.

CouchDB

Pros:

  • Highly available and fault-tolerant due to its distributed nature
  • Supports multi-version concurrency control (MVCC) for better data handling
  • Flexible data model using JSON documents
  • Built-in replication and synchronization features
  • RESTful HTTP/JSON API for easy integration

Cons:

  • Performance can degrade with large datasets if not managed properly
  • Limited querying capabilities compared to traditional SQL databases
  • Not ideal for complex transactions

GridGain In-Memory Data Fabric

Pros:

  • High-performance in-memory data processing
  • Supports SQL, key-value, and other data access methods
  • Scalability with distributed architecture
  • Advanced caching capabilities for improved speed
  • Real-time analytics and streaming capabilities

Cons:

  • In-memory data can be lost in case of failure unless properly configured
  • Higher operational costs due to memory usage
  • Complexity in managing distributed systems

Compare CouchDB

vs
Compare ArangoDB and CouchDB and decide which is most suitable for you.
vs
Compare Apache Cassandra and CouchDB and decide which is most suitable for you.
vs
Compare CouchBase and CouchDB and decide which is most suitable for you.
vs
Compare H2 Database Engine and CouchDB and decide which is most suitable for you.
vs
Compare Hazelcast and CouchDB and decide which is most suitable for you.
vs
Compare MariaDB and CouchDB and decide which is most suitable for you.
vs
Compare Microsoft SQL Server and CouchDB and decide which is most suitable for you.
vs
Compare MongoDB and CouchDB and decide which is most suitable for you.
vs
Compare MySQL Community Edition and CouchDB and decide which is most suitable for you.
vs
Compare PostgreSQL and CouchDB and decide which is most suitable for you.
vs
Compare Redis and CouchDB and decide which is most suitable for you.
vs
Compare RethinkDB and CouchDB and decide which is most suitable for you.